LDAP的基本概念
LDAP是轻量目录访问协议(Lightweight Directory Access Protocol)的缩写,是一种基于 客户机/服务器模式的目录服务访问协议.其实是一话号码簿,LDAP是一种特殊的数据库。
专用名词解释:
DN=Distinguished Name 一个目录条目的名字 CN=Common Name 为用户名或服务器名,最长可以到80个字符,可以为中文; OU=Organization Unit为组织单元,最多可以有四级,每级最长32个字符,可以为中文; O=Organization 为组织名,可以3—64个字符长 C=Country为国家名,可选,为2个字符长 L=Location 地名,通常是城市的名称 ST 州或省的名称 O=Orgnization 组织名称 OU=Orgnizagion Unit 组织单位 STREET 街道地址 UID 用户标识 DC=Domain Component CN=Common Name
LDAP目录类似于文件系统目录,下列目录:DC=redmond,DC=wa,DC=microsoft,DC=com
如果我们类比文件系统的话,可被看作如下文件路径:Com\Microsoft\Wa\Redmond
相关推荐
#### 一、LDAP基本概念 LDAP(Lightweight Directory Access Protocol),即轻量目录访问协议,是一种基于客户机/服务器模式的目录服务访问协议。它类似于一个电子版的电话簿,用于存储和检索组织结构、用户信息等...
### LDAP Schema的概念与基本要素详解 #### 一、引言 在现代企业级应用中,LDAP(Lightweight Directory Access Protocol,轻量...希望本文能帮助读者更好地理解LDAP Schema的相关知识,并能够在实际工作中加以应用。
"LDAP入门知识" LDAP(Lightweight Directory Access Protocol)是基于X.500标准的,但是简单多了并且可以根据需要定制。LDAP支持TCP/IP,这对访问Internet是必须的。LDAP的核心规范在RFC中都有定义,所有与LDAP...
#### 二、LDAP基础知识 在深入了解示例代码之前,我们先简要介绍一些LDAP的基础概念: 1. **DN (Distinguished Name)**:标识目录条目的唯一名称,由一系列属性组成。 2. **RDN (Relative Distinguished Name)**:...
四、LDAP基本操作 1. Bind(认证):这是LDAP交互的基础,客户端通过发送包含DN和密码的消息进行认证。认证过程可以通过LDAPS(使用TCP 636端口,类似HTTPS)或StartTLS(在TCP 389端口上启动TLS协商)实现加密保护...
LDAP基本模型** LDAP目录服务的核心概念包括DN(Distinguished Name)和Schema。DN是唯一标识目录条目的字符串,而Schema定义了目录中的数据结构,包括语法、匹配规则、属性类型和对象类。 **7. LDAP目录设计** ...
### LDAP应用程序接口知识点详解 #### 一、简介 **LDAP**(Lightweight Directory Access Protocol,轻型目录访问协议)是一种应用层协议,主要用于查询、浏览和管理存储在目录服务中的信息。目录服务常用于存储...
这个主题涉及几个关键知识点,包括Java LDAP API、SSL安全连接以及如何通过代码操作LDAP目录。 首先,LDAP是一个开放标准的协议,用于存储和检索用户、组、计算机等对象的数据。这些数据通常分布在多台服务器上,...
#### 知识点概览 1. **LDAP简介** 2. **Python LDAP模块介绍** 3. **Python脚本配置与执行** 4. **脚本解析** - 连接LDAP服务器 - 搜索过滤器 - 处理搜索结果 - 错误处理 5. **最佳实践与优化建议** #### 1. ...
首先,我们需要理解LDAP的基本概念。LDAP是一种分布式数据库,采用层次结构存储数据,通常用于存储用户账户信息。它允许客户端应用程序通过标准协议查询和修改这些信息,包括用户的密码。在企业环境中,LDAP服务器如...
### LDAP开发SampleCode知识点解析 #### 一、LDAP简介与应用 - **LDAP**(Lightweight Directory Access Protocol)是一种基于TCP/IP的应用层协议,用于访问和管理目录服务。它最初是为了替代X.500而设计的一种轻量...
1. **LDAP基础知识**:解释LDAP的基本概念,包括目录服务、DN(Distinguished Name)和UID(User ID)。目录服务是存储和检索信息的高效系统,DN是唯一标识目录对象的字符串,而UID通常代表用户账户。 2. **AD与...
**LDAP的基本模型** - **信息模型**:描述了如何表示和组织目录中的信息。 - **命名模型**:定义了数据在目录树中的组织方式。 - **功能模型**:定义了对数据的操作,如查找、添加、修改和删除。 - **安全模型**:...
1. **LDAP协议基础**:首先,你需要了解LDAP的基本概念,包括其架构、目录服务的工作原理以及如何通过 LDAP 协议进行数据存储和检索。LDAP 使用树形结构来组织信息,每个条目(Entry)都有一个唯一的标识符(DN,...
1. **LDAP基本概念** - **目录服务**:是存储和检索结构化数据的系统,通常用于管理网络中的用户身份和资源。 - **DN(Distinguished Name)**:是 LDAP 对象的唯一标识符,包含了对象的所有上下文信息。 - **CN...
首先,我们需要理解LDAP的基本概念。LDAP是一种客户端-服务器模型,允许用户通过查询目录服务来获取信息。它使用ASN.1(抽象语法符号一号)编码规则,支持多种认证机制,如简单的绑定、SASL(安全认证层系统)等。 ...
1. **LDAP协议基础**:了解LDAP的基本概念,包括目录结构、DN(Distinguished Name)、过滤器、属性等。 2. **C语言网络编程**:掌握套接字编程,理解TCP/IP通信模型,熟悉socket API。 3. **LDAP API**:学习如何...
**LDAP(Lightweight Directory Access Protocol)轻量级目录访问协议** LDAP是一种用于访问和管理分布式目录服务的标准协议,常用于企业环境中存储用户账户...理解这些知识点对于管理和维护基于LDAP的系统至关重要。
在实际开发中,使用LDAP的Java应用可能会涉及到以下知识点: 1. **目录服务基础**:理解LDAP的目录结构,包括DN(Distinguished Name)和RDN(Relative Distinguished Name),以及如何组织和查询数据。 2. **JNDI...
1. **LDAP基本概念**:解释了LDAP的起源、作用以及在现代网络环境中的重要性。它是一种开放的标准,允许用户跨多个系统和平台查询和管理数据。 2. **目录服务架构**:探讨了LDAP目录服务的层次结构,包括根目录、域...